1962 AC Greyhound vs. 1968 Holden Monaro

To start off, 1968 Holden Monaro is newer by 6 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1962 AC Greyhound.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1962 AC Greyhound would be higher. At 3,043 cc (6 cylinders), 1968 Holden Monaro is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1962 AC Greyhound (123 HP @ 5750 RPM) has 15 more horse power than 1968 Holden Monaro. (108 HP @ 4200 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1962 AC Greyhound should accelerate faster than 1968 Holden Monaro.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1968 Holden Monaro weights approximately 275 kg more than 1962 AC Greyhound.

Let's talk about torque, 1968 Holden Monaro (245 Nm) has 66 more torque (in Nm) than 1962 AC Greyhound. (179 Nm). This means 1968 Holden Monaro will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1962 AC Greyhound.

Compare all specifications:

1962 AC Greyhound 1968 Holden Monaro
Make AC Holden
Model Greyhound Monaro
Year Released 1962 1968
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1971 cc 3043 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 123 HP 108 HP
Engine RPM 5750 RPM 4200 RPM
Torque 179 Nm 245 Nm
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Vehicle Weight 1015 kg 1290 kg
Vehicle Length 4580 mm 4700 mm
Vehicle Width 1670 mm 1830 mm
Vehicle Height 1340 mm 1400 mm
Wheelbase Size 2550 mm 2830 mm
